1. 首页 > 科技

若以地址高端作为栈底 向顺序栈压入元素时

如今兄弟们对于若以地址高端作为栈底令人意想不到,兄弟们都需要剖析一下若以地址高端作为栈底,那么春儿也在网络上收集了一些对于向顺序栈压入元素时的一些内容来分享给兄弟们,原因竟然是这样,兄弟们一起来了解一下吧。

数据结构中地址高端作为栈底,进栈top怎么变

你这种思想就是最容易出现的惯性思维.栈顶可以是最低地址,这样的话,push的时候要加1.栈顶还可以是最高地址,这样的话push的时候要减1.具体要看栈顶的相对地.

若以地址高端作为栈底 向顺序栈压入元素时

在一个具有n个单元的顺序栈中,假设以地址高端作为栈顶.

我觉得应该是C,参考严蔚敏的数据结构栈那一张

在存储器堆栈中,若堆栈从地址大的位置向地址小的位置生成,栈底地址.

因为堆栈从地址大的位置向地址小的位置生成,即入栈操作SP减小,所以答案为: B.将SP的值减1,然后将数据写入堆栈

栈是高地址向低地址的延伸,那为什么进栈时会是TOP++呢

因为首地址是低地址,比如首地址是100,下一个地址就是101,当然是TOP++了.再看看别人怎么说的.

数据结构题.答案选择B,麻烦解释下.

首地址是BA 那么 A[1,1]地址就是BA 然后每个数组元素展3个字节即3个内存地址 以列为主 A[1,1] A[2,1] A[3,1] 同理一直到A[8,1] 然后下一个就是A[1,2] 一直到A[4,8]共60个.

计算机二级公共基础,栈,求解

从30往下数 栈底指针指向49 一共有20个元素 栈为空时,栈底指针指向49 栈顶指针指向50(因为是50容量的栈 ) 开始往栈内放数据之后 每放一个 栈顶指针便-1 所以 当栈顶指针是30的时候,栈内已经有20个元素了

已知(SS)=1000H (SP)=0100H 堆栈段的段首地址 = ? 栈.

堆栈段的段首地址 = 16*1000=10000H 栈顶地址=10000+SP=10100H 若该段最后一个单元地址为10200H,则栈底=10200-10000=200H

堆栈中的高,低地址是什么意思,属于汇编知识还是其他谢谢.

堆栈是在内存中指定的一段特殊存储区,春起始单元的地址叫栈底,当前存储单元地址叫栈顶,堆栈存储区一旦指定,栈底就固定不变了,而栈顶是随入栈、出栈操作呈动态.而不同机型的堆栈设计,有两种情况:一是每入栈一个数,栈顶地址加1,每出栈一个数,栈顶地址减1,即堆栈区是由内存的低地址向高地址.另一种是每入栈一个数,栈顶地址减1,每出栈一个数,栈顶地址加1,即堆栈区是由内存的高地址向低地址. 高地址、低地址的概念.

计算机组成原理的题目 来高手啊

《计算机组成原理》试题-1 一、单项选择题(在每小题的四个备选答案中,选出一个正确的答案,并将其代码填在题干后的括号内.每小题1分,共15分) 1.若十进制数据为137.5则其八进制数为( ). A、89.8 B、211.4 C、. A、立即寻址 B、变址寻址 C、间接寻址 D、寄存器寻址 10.堆栈指针SP的内容是( ). A、栈顶单元内容 B、栈顶单元地址 C、栈底单元内容 D、栈底单元地址 11.高速缓冲存储器Cache一般采取( ). A、随机存取方式 B、.

单片机习题求解答

1 、访问外部数据存储器使用的16位地址指针是 (B) A. PC B.DPTR C.R0 D.R1 2 、下列( C )条指令,是位寻址方式. A.MOV A,#10H B.MOV A,10H C.MOV C,10H D.MOV A,R1 3、使用减指令SUBB进行低位减时要加一条( A )指令 A. CLR C B.CLR A C.SETB C D. JC AA1 4、若A=FOH ,C=1,执行下列指令后,能使A=78H的指令是( C ) A. RL A B.RLC A C. RR A D. RRC A 5、压缩BCD码84H表示的真值用十进制表示为( B ) A. 10 B.84 .

这篇文章到这里就已经结束了,希望对兄弟们有所帮助。